Understanding Paint Types and Their Characteristics

Different paint types offer distinct characteristics suitable for various applications in house painting. For instance, comparing latex vs. oil paints reveals differences in drying time, durability, and ease of cleanup.

Latex paints are generally preferred for most interior and exterior projects due to their flexibility, breathability, and quick drying times. Oil-based paints, while more durable and resistant to stains, require more ventilation and longer drying periods, as discussed in our article on latex vs oil-based paint for more.

  • Latex/Acrylic Paints: Water-based, easy to clean, quick-drying, flexible, and resistant to cracking. Ideal for most interior and exterior surfaces.
  • Oil-Based/Alkyd Paints: Durable, hard-wearing, excellent for high-traffic areas and trim, but have longer drying times and strong odors.
  • Primers: Essential for adhesion, hiding previous colors, and sealing porous surfaces. Different primers are available for various substrates, including wood, metal, and drywall.
  • Specialty Paints: Include options like mildew-resistant paint for bathrooms, low-VOC (Volatile Organic Compound) paints for better air quality, and elastomeric paints for superior flexibility on exterior surfaces.

How Much Does House Painting Cost in Edmonton?

Understanding the investment required for professional house painting in Edmonton is crucial for homeowners planning a renovation. The cost can vary significantly based on several factors, including the size of your home, the complexity of the job, and the materials chosen.

When considering your budget, it’s helpful to know that repainting can offer an excellent return on investment. High-quality paintwork not only enhances curb appeal but also protects your home’s exterior, potentially increasing its market value. For a comprehensive overview of painting services, refer to our Edmonton Painting Services Guide.

Several elements contribute to the overall price of a house painting project. These typically include labour, paint quality, preparation work, and any specialized techniques or equipment required.

FactorImpact on Cost
Home SizeLarger homes naturally require more paint and labour, increasing the total cost.
Surface ConditionExtensive preparation, such as scraping, sanding, or repairing damaged surfaces, adds to labour time and material expenses.
Paint Type and QualityPremium paints, like those designed for Edmonton’s climate, often cost more but offer superior durability and finish. Understanding the differences between latex vs. oil paint can also influence your budget.
Number of CoatsMore coats of paint, especially when changing colours dramatically or covering dark shades, will increase material and labour costs.
Architectural DetailsHomes with intricate trim, multiple colours, or difficult-to-reach areas demand more time and specialized skill, impacting the final price.
Time of YearWhile not a direct cost factor, painting during off-peak seasons might sometimes offer more competitive pricing, though weather can be a challenge. Our guide on the best time to paint your house in Edmonton offers further insights.

When is the Best Time for House Painting in Edmonton?

Timing is crucial for successful house painting in Edmonton, largely due to the city’s distinct seasonal weather patterns. Selecting the optimal period ensures that paint adheres properly, cures effectively, and ultimately lasts longer, protecting your investment.

Proper planning around the climate can significantly impact the durability and appearance of your house painting project, whether you are tackling an exterior or interior job. Our team understands how to navigate Edmonton’s unique weather challenges to achieve the best results. If you’re unsure about the process, our comprehensive guide on how to choose house painters can help you make an informed decision.

Here are the key advantages of timing your house painting project correctly:

  1. Optimal Temperature Range: Paint requires specific temperature conditions to dry and cure correctly, typically between 10°C and 25°C.
  2. Low Humidity: Reduced humidity levels minimize the risk of moisture getting trapped under the paint film, preventing issues like blistering or peeling.
  3. Adequate Drying Time: Longer daylight hours and consistent weather allow for multiple coats to be applied and dried thoroughly between applications.
  4. Better Adhesion: Ideal conditions promote stronger adhesion of the paint to the surface, enhancing its longevity and protective qualities.
  5. Minimized Disruptions: Scheduling during stable weather reduces unexpected delays due to rain, snow, or extreme cold, making the process smoother.

Summer: The Prime Season for Exterior Painting

Summer is widely considered the best time for exterior house painting in Edmonton. The consistent warmth and lower humidity levels during July and August create ideal conditions for paint application and curing. This period minimizes the risk of paint failure due to adverse weather.

Longer daylight hours also mean painting crews have more time to work, leading to quicker project completion and fewer interruptions. Our guide to exterior painting in Edmonton further explains why summer offers a distinct advantage for your home’s facade.

Spring and Fall: Considerations for House Painting

While summer is ideal, spring (late May to June) and early fall (September to early October) can also be suitable for house painting, especially for interior projects. These seasons offer milder temperatures, which can be beneficial for controlling indoor climate during painting. However, exterior painting during these times requires careful monitoring of daily temperatures and humidity.

Early spring and late fall often bring unpredictable weather, including frost, rain, or sudden temperature drops, which can compromise the quality of exterior paint jobs. It’s essential to consult with professionals who understand how weather affects exterior painting in Edmonton for more.

Winter: Interior Painting Focus

Winter in Edmonton is generally not suitable for exterior house painting due to freezing temperatures and heavy snowfall. However, it’s an excellent time to focus on interior painting projects. With the windows closed and heating on, indoor temperatures remain stable, providing an optimal environment for paint to dry and cure properly.

Many homeowners choose winter for interior renovations, including painting, as it often means less demand for painters and potentially more flexible scheduling. The Importance of Surface Preparation for House Painting

Thorough surface preparation is arguably the most critical step for any successful house painting project. Without it, even the highest quality paint and skilled application will fall short, leading to premature peeling, cracking, or an uneven finish.

Step-by-step home exterior prep guide for Edmonton residents including cleaning, repairing, priming, and specific considerations.

Proper preparation ensures optimal paint adhesion, enhances durability, and ultimately contributes to the aesthetic quality of the finished surface. This foundational work directly impacts the longevity and appearance of your investment in home painting Edmonton.

Ignoring this stage can result in costly reworks and dissatisfaction with the outcome. Our team emphasizes the importance of meticulously preparing surfaces, whether for interior walls or exterior painting services.

Key steps in effective surface preparation for house painting include:

  • Cleaning: Removing dirt, grime, mildew, and loose paint chips is essential. For exterior surfaces, power washing can be effective, followed by appropriate drying time. For interiors, a simple wipe-down with a damp cloth and mild detergent often suffices. Our guide on how to prep walls for painting offers detailed advice.
  • Sanding: Smooth surfaces are vital for a uniform paint application. Sanding helps to remove imperfections, feather out existing paint edges, and create a profile for new paint to adhere to. This is especially important for areas with old, flaky paint.
  • Repairs: Any cracks, holes, or damaged areas must be repaired before painting. This includes filling nail holes, patching drywall, and addressing any structural issues that could compromise the paint finish.
  • Priming: Applying a suitable primer creates a consistent base for the topcoat. Primer helps with adhesion, blocks stains, and ensures true colour representation. Different primers are available for various surfaces and paint types, as discussed in our Edmonton exterior paint guide.
  • Masking and Taping: Protecting adjacent surfaces like trim, windows, and floors with painter’s tape and drop cloths prevents unwanted paint splatters and ensures clean lines. This meticulous step saves time on cleanup and yields professional results for house painters Edmonton.

By dedicating sufficient time and effort to these preparation steps, you lay the groundwork for a beautiful and long-lasting house painting project. It’s a commitment that pays dividends in the final look and durability of your painted surfaces.

Edmonton’s Climate and Its Impact on House Painting

Edmonton’s unique climate presents distinct challenges and considerations for any house painting project. From harsh winters to warm summers, these fluctuating conditions directly influence paint durability, application, and overall longevity. Understanding how the weather affects house painting is crucial for achieving a finish that withstands the elements.

The city experiences significant temperature swings, high humidity at times, and intense UV radiation. These factors can accelerate paint degradation if the wrong products or application methods are used. Our team specializes in understanding Edmonton’s weather woes and how they impact exterior surfaces.

Choosing the appropriate paint is paramount to a successful outcome in this environment. Specialized paints designed for extreme temperatures and moisture resistance are often recommended. We can help you choose the right exterior paint for Edmonton’s climate to ensure maximum protection and aesthetic appeal.

Key climatic factors affecting house painting include:

  • Temperature Fluctuations: Extreme heat and cold cause materials to expand and contract, which can lead to cracking and peeling if the paint lacks flexibility.
  • Moisture and Humidity: High humidity can prolong drying times and affect paint adhesion, while excessive moisture can promote mildew growth.
  • UV Radiation: Intense sunlight, especially during long summer days, can cause colours to fade and paint to break down over time.
  • Wind: Strong winds can carry dust and debris, compromising the quality of wet paint surfaces.
  • Precipitation: Rain and snow impact the timing of exterior projects and require careful scheduling to ensure dry application conditions.

Proper surface preparation becomes even more critical in Edmonton to combat these environmental challenges. This often involves thorough cleaning, repair of any existing damage, and the application of suitable primers. This meticulous approach helps create a strong bond for the paint, extending the life of your exterior painting services.
